How they compare

Sint Maarten (Dutch part) currently reports 3.11 billion current LCU against 2.03 billion current LCU in East Timor, a difference of 1.09 billion current LCU.

That makes Sint Maarten (Dutch part)'s figure about 1.5 times East Timor's.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 16 shared years of data; in 2009 it was East Timor ahead.

Globally, Sint Maarten (Dutch part) ranks 197th and East Timor ranks 198th of 209 countries.

Gross national income is the total income earned by all residents within an economic territory during an accounting period. It is equal to gross domestic product plus earned income receivable from abroad minus earned income payable abroad. This indicator is expressed in current prices, meaning no adjustment has been made to account for price changes over time. This series is expressed in local currency units.
